Is Mona worth building?

Mona is a hugely rewarding off-field damage amplifier: a single Burst stamps the Omen that magnifies every hit your team lands, and she applies clean Hydro for Freeze and Vaporize teams. What she needs most is enough Energy Recharge to Burst every rotation, then CRIT if you want her to chip in personal damage. Don't sweat the weapon: the 4-star Widsith rivals many 5-stars, and a 4pc Emblem of Severed Fate both fits her kit and farms easily. A lightweight support that lifts the whole team.

Talent priority

Q > E > NA — the Burst plants the damage-amplifying Omen so level it first; the Hydro-applying Skill next, and Normal Attacks are skipped.

Stellaris Phantasm
Mona summons the sparkling waves and creates a reflection of the starry sky, applying the Illusory Bubble status to opponents in a large AoE.

Illusory Bubble
Traps opponents inside a pocket of destiny and also makes them Wet. Renders weaker opponents immobile.
When an opponent affected by Illusory Bubble sustains DMG, it has the following effects:
·Applies an Omen to the opponent, which gives a DMG Bonus, also increasing the DMG of the attack that causes it.
·Removes the Illusory Bubble, dealing Hydro DMG in the process.

Omen
During its duration, increases DMG taken by opponents.

Combat Rotation

  1. Open with E "Mirror Reflection of Doom" to summon the Phantom, tagging enemies with Hydro and drawing aggro (12s CD).
  2. Fire off a Charged Attack for extra AoE Hydro application before swapping off.
  3. Switch to the main DPS and hit the tagged enemies to trigger elemental reactions (Vaporize/Freeze/Electro-Charged).
  4. Once enemies are grouped and Mona has 60 energy, unleash Q "Stellaris Phantasm" for the Illusory Bubble plus Omen status (15s CD).
  5. During the 4s Omen window, keep the main DPS attacking non-stop to cash in the full damage amplification.
  6. Use the 8s Illusory Bubble duration to keep enemies from slipping out of the amplified zone.
  7. Retreat Mona off-field to let E's 12s CD tick down, prioritizing Energy Recharge gear to hit 60 energy every rotation.

Mona constellations

C1
Prophecy of Submersion

When any of your own party members hits an opponent affected by an Omen, the effects of Hydro-related Elemental Reactions are enhanced for 8s:
· Electro-Charged DMG increases by 15%, Lunar-Charged DMG increases by 15%, Vaporize DMG increases by 15%, Hydro Swirl DMG increases by 15%, Lunar-Crystallize DMG increases by 15%.
· Frozen duration is extended by 15%.

C2
Lunar Chain

When a Normal Attack hits, there is a 20% chance that it will be automatically followed by a Charged Attack.
This effect can only occur once every 5s.

C3
Restless Revolution

Increases the Level of Stellaris Phantasm by 3.
Maximum upgrade level is 15.

C4
Prophecy of Oblivion

When any party member attacks an opponent affected by an Omen, their CRIT Rate is increased by 15%.

C5
Mockery of Fortuna

Increases the Level of Mirror Reflection of Doom by 3.
Maximum upgrade level is 15.

C6
Rhetorics of Calamitas

Upon entering Illusory Torrent, Mona gains a 60% increase to the DMG of her next Charged Attack per second of movement.
A maximum DMG Bonus of 180% can be achieved in this manner. The effect lasts for no more than 8s.
